Summary

Whitney Center opened in 1979 with 202 independent living apartments and 59 skilled nursing beds.  Over time, consumer preferences for larger apartments and insufficient IL turnover necessitated the combination of some IL apartments and designation of specific IL units for assisted living.  Whitney Center is currently comprised of 178 IL apartments, 6 assisted living units and a 59 bed SNF. 

Planning began in 2006 and an advance registration program began in 2008. The number of confirmed depositors required for expansion financing was achieved in summer 2009.

On December 2, 2009, Whitney Center broke ground on the Renaissance Expansion, a two-phase project that will be contained within the community's 15-acre site. Earlier that same day, $89 million in tax-exempt bonds were issue to enable the beginning of the project.

Phase One is the addition of 87 one-, two-, and three-bedroom apartments in a new seven-story building, a 218-seat Cultural Arts Center, a bistro/marketplace and expanded and redesigned main dining room, new parking garage, and a glass-walled interior promenade called Main Street. An art gallery, salon/spa, business center, mailing center and expanded library will be found along Main Street.

Phase Two is slated to begin in 2014 and includes the replacement of the current Health Center building with a new four-story Health and Wellness Center that addresses Assisted Living, rehabilitation, skilled nursing and memory support living. Phase Two also supports Whitney Center's Life Care program, which guarantees all residents continuing care should their health needs ever require it.

Eventus Role

Whitney Center retained Eventus Strategic Partners in January 2006 as its development manager to revise the previously conceived concept plan and manage the continuing development of this project.
